
entity如何使用java
用户关注问题
什么是Java中的Entity?
我在学习Java开发时遇到了Entity这个术语,它具体指的是什么?
Java中Entity的定义
Entity在Java中通常指的是持久化对象,代表数据库中的一张表。通过Java的JPA(Java Persistence API),Entity类能够映射数据库表,实现对象与数据库数据的交互。
如何在Java项目中创建一个Entity类?
我想知道创建Entity类需要哪些步骤,有什么必备的注解?
创建Java Entity类的基本步骤
创建Entity类时,需要在类上使用@Entity注解来标识该类为一个实体。此外,还需要为实体类定义主键字段,并使用@Id注解标识主键。字段对应数据库列,通常会使用@Column注解进行配置。
如何使用Entity管理数据库操作?
我怎样通过Entity对象完成数据库的增删改查操作?
使用Entity进行数据库操作的方法
可以通过EntityManager来管理Entity对象,实现数据库操作。EntityManager提供的方法如persist()用于新增,find()用于查询,merge()用于更新,remove()用于删除。配合事务管理,能确保数据一致性。